A little background - I've had a Kole Tang in QT for about 5 weeks now. I tried to treat him prophylactically with Cupramine, but he did not respond well (stopped eating). I removed all the copper and observed him for a couple weeks. He has been very energetic and has been eating like a pig. I haven't seen any spots on him, but I did notice some blotches on his right pectoral fin last week.
Yesterday, I started tank transfer to ensure he did not have any ich parasites. He ate well yesterday, and was his normal active self. This morning, I noticed that he was just hanging out in the front lower left corner of the tank. He wasn't zipping around the tank like he normally does, and his breathing rate seemed to be elevated. After watching him for about 15 minutes, I noticed him pass some yellowish mucoid feces that were somewhat stringy. I found this strange, as he has been through two treatments of Prazipro which ended over two weeks ago. I went ahead and dosed 5ml of Prazi to the tank to be sure.
I gave him a few mysis this morning, and he showed a bit of interest at first, but then spit out the one piece he ate. I have some nori banded to the PVC elbow in the tank, but he has not eaten any. He does swim up to the nori from time to time acting like he is interested, but doesn't partake.
Any ideas what could be going on? His color looks normal, and he seems alert otherwise. He is in fresh saltwater which was aerated for 48 hours, and the salinity is within .001 of his previous tank. I also dosed 2ml of Prime last night to make sure there was no ammonia. Below is a video showing his current condition.
